Scientist- Oligonucleotide Analytics

Key responsibilities:
- Develop and validate analytical methods using advanced instrumentation for therapeutic oligonucleotide drug substances and drug products.
- Apply sound scientific principles to perform laboratory research.

Minimum qualifications:
- Fresh Ph.D in Biochemistry, Analytical Chemistry, or Chemistry with knowledge of Therapeutic Oligonucleotides is preferred. A Master’s degree in Biochemistry with at least 5 years of experience, preferably in oligonucleotide research, will also be considered.
- Knowledge of basic laboratory techniques and instrumentation used for analytical characterization of complex pharmaceutical products.
- Excellent oral and written communication and organizational skills.
- Ability to multi-task and drive multiple projects and assigned responsibilities.
- Ability to write comprehensive technical reports and communicate complex concepts across functions.
- Proficiency in speaking, comprehending, reading, and writing English.
- General understanding of current regulatory policies applicable to pharmaceutical industry practice and regulations (preferred).
